I've contacted libarchive devs and they suggested --numeric-owner bsdtar
option. It works just as I expect it to.
pacman already only uses the numeric id's during extraction.
It might be libarchive bug/feature. I've found
archive_write_disk_set_standard_lookup()
which will force resolving uid/gid's if used. The trick is, version 3.3.0 I
compiled
packman against, calls such function almost uncoditionally in
archive_read_extract().
https://github.com/libarchive/libarchive/blob/master/libarchive/archive_read_extract.c#L49
Aha, how nice of them. Things like this are why I don't recommend
using --root to manage chroot's. I suppose I need to get around to
finishing alpm's user handling.
apg
A potential solution would be to port pacman to archive_read_extract2(), which
archive_read_extract() currently wraps.
I'll wait and see what's the libarchive upstream thought on this.
